Abstract

The invention relates to a method for recycling lignin from low-boiling alcohol method pulping waste liquor, which relates to the technical field of pulping papermaking engineering. The method for recycling the lignin from the low-boiling alcohol method pulping waste liquor is applicable to the waste liquor which is obtained by boiling reagent of plant raw materials with low-boiling alcohols, the waste liquor is processed in steps such as flash evaporation, diluting, cooling, precipitation, filtering, separating, drying and the like to obtain lignin, calcium hydroxide is added in filter liquor, and the precipitate is filtered, separated and dried again to obtain low-molecule lignin. The method has characteristics of high recycling rate, less investment, no pollution and low energy consumption.

Background technology
Along with the rapid development of economy, China increases sharply to the demand of pulp and paper.Yet well-known, China still adopts traditional pulping process in a lot of pulp mills, and waste liquid recovery energy consumption is high, investment is large, still can produce secondary pollution, brings very large pressure for environment and the energy.Therefore, China classifies the clearer production technology of greatly developing paper pulp processed as key content in " pulping and paper-making ' 11th Five-Year ' planning ".Given this, seek and a kind ofly new can effectively reclaim the utility such as lignin, the pulping process of protection of the environment preferably again, having become paper industry needs the urgent problem that solves.
The Organosolv Pulping that grew up in the last few years can provide better delignification method, leaves more response function group in the lignin of degraded, the hemicellulose, and can easierly reclaim from solvent medium, purify.Organosolv pulping is a kind of pulping technique to the environment friendliness, under certain condition, the lignin of organic solvent in can degrade plant material, thus reach lignin, cellulose, the efficient purpose of separating of hemicellulose.Because what adopt in the whole process is organic solvent separation, hydrolysis or dissolved lignin, and organic solvent can be by Distillation recovery and by repeatedly recycle and reuse, without waste water or only have a small amount of discharge of wastewater, can really solve the pollution problem the pulping process from the source, be the effective technical way of realizing pollution-free or low pollution " environmental protection " slurrying.
The low pure method slurrying of boiling is one of the most typical pulping process in the organic solvent pulping, the studied low pure method pulping technique that boils that acid catalysis, base catalysis, peroxide catalyzed and self-catalysis are arranged, this patent belong to the low pure legal system pulp waste that boils and reclaim and the comprehensive utilization category.Reclaiming lignin from the low pure method pulping waste liquor that boils, is the important component part of the low pure legal system pulp waste recovery technology of boiling, and is equivalent to the important component that refining goes out from plant fiber material----lignin.
Summary of the invention
The purpose of this invention is to provide a kind of method that from the low pure method pulping waste liquor that boils, reclaims lignin, it is the waste liquid that obtains after master's the reagent boiling that this recovery method is applicable to the low alcohol that boils of plant material employing, waste liquid is through processes such as flash distillation, dilution, cooling, precipitating, isolated by filtration and dryings, obtain lignin, filtrate is added calcium hydroxide, the gained precipitation is carried out isolated by filtration, drying again, obtains low molecule lignin.
A kind of method that reclaims lignin from the low pure method pulping waste liquor that boils comprises the step that flash distillation dilution, filtration drying, filtrate are processed, and comprises following processing step:
1. flash distillation dilution: the waste liquid that will utilize the low pure legal system slurry that boils to produce carries out flash distillation to be processed, the concentration of hanging down the alcohol that boils in the waste liquid after the flash distillation is down to 15% ~ 50%(V/V), and temperature is down to 95 ℃ ~ 100 ℃, with above-mentioned waste liquid dilution, make the concentration to 5% of the low alcohol that boils ~ 35%(V/V), after be cooled to 5 ~ 40 ℃;
2. filtration drying: with step 1. the gained waste liquid filter, solid carries out drying, gets lignin;
3. filtrate is processed: to step 2. gained filtrate add calcium hydroxide, precipitating filters, dryly must hang down the molecule lignin.
The waste liquid that the low pure legal system slurry that boils produces in the method for recovery lignin of the present invention is main mixture by low boil alcohol, water, lignin, degraded sugar, organic acid, furfural and ash composition, wherein, boiling 100g fibrous raw material, lignin content is generally 6 ~ 30g in the waste liquid.
The low pure legal system slurry that boils described in the method for recovery lignin of the present invention refers to be preferably methyl alcohol or ethanol among the present invention take the low alcohol that boils as the pulping process of boiling main agents.
The low employed raw material of the pure method slurrying papermaking plant fiber material that can be used for slurrying known to those skilled in the art that boils described in the method for recovery lignin of the present invention, the present invention is preferably wood type, grass or bast class papermaking plant fiber material, more preferably poplar, reed, wheat straw, bagasse.
The catalysis method that is used for slurrying known to those skilled in the art of the low pure method pulping process that boils described in the method for recovery lignin of the present invention, preferred salt catalysis method of the present invention, autocatalytic method, peroxide catalyzed method or base catalysis method.
Principle of the present invention be lignin in the plant fiber material under the catalysis of acid (or alkali, salt, peroxide), high temperature degradation also is dissolved in the low alcohol-water solution of boiling, delignification, carbohydrate Partial digestion, fiber dispersion pulping.The gained waste liquid reclaims the accessory substances such as lignin, degraded sugar, furfural, organic acid, but the low alcohol-water solution reuse boiling of boiling.
In the method for recovery lignin of the present invention preferred described step 1. in after the dilution in the waste liquid the low determining alcohol that boils be 15% ~ 30%(V/V), after be cooled to 15 ~ 25 ℃.
The temperature of the waste liquid that the preferred described low pure legal system slurry that boils produces in the method for recovery lignin of the present invention is 160 ~ 220 ℃, and the low determining alcohol that boils is 40% ~ 65%(V/V), and the temperature of preferred waste liquid is 170 ~ 210 ℃, the low determining alcohol 45% ~ 60%(V/V) that boils.
To be used for the solvent of waste liquid dilution in 1. be water to preferred described step in the method for recovery lignin of the present invention.
In the method for recovery lignin of the present invention preferred described step 3. the addition of calcium hydroxide be 2 ~ 10g/L, more preferably 3 ~ 6g/L.
Utilize the method for recovery lignin of the present invention to carry out the lignin recovery, 100g plant fiber material lignin yield 5 ~ 25g, low molecule lignin yield 0.1 ~ 3g.
The invention has the beneficial effects as follows:
(1) recyclable high added value lignin.
(2) reduced investment.Owing to using common apparatus, can reduce investment outlay.
(3) accessory substance purity is high.After reclaiming lignin, waste liquid colourity reduces, solid content descends, destroyed the complicated azeotrope system that higher boil organic acid participates in the system, created conditions for from waste liquid, reclaiming the accessory substances such as the low alcohol that boils, water and degraded sugar, furfural, formic acid, acetic acid, and can improve the purity that reclaims accessory substance.
(4) pollution-free.Reclaim in the lignin process and produce, discharge without any pollutant.
(5) energy consumption is low.Waste liquid has reduced the concentration of low boil alcohol, higher boil organic acid by flash distillation, the ability of dissolved lignin reduces, and is beneficial to lignin and separates out, and reduces the consumption of follow-up dilution water, and system amount of residual heat will after taking full advantage of simultaneously boiling and finishing effectively reduces waste liquid and reclaims energy consumption.

Embodiment 1
A kind of method that from the low pure method pulping waste liquor that boils, reclaims lignin, pulping waste liquor is from reed by ethanol-water-hydrogen peroxide adverse current slurrying, and the lignin recycling step is as follows:
1. flash distillation dilution: 170 ℃ of dense waste liquid temperatures, concentration of alcohol are 45%, and after the flash tank flash distillation, temperature is reduced to 95 ℃, and concentration of alcohol is reduced to 30%, and being diluted to concentration of alcohol with the normal temperature water for industrial use is 18%, is cooled to 20 ℃ through heat exchanger;
2. filtration drying: the lignin of precipitating is through filtering, after the drying, obtaining lignin, 100g reed raw material results lignin 12g;
3. filtrate is processed: add calcium hydroxide in filtrate, addition is 4g/L, and precipitating is filtered, drying obtains low molecule lignin, the low molecule lignin 0.4g of 100g reed raw material results.
Embodiment 2
A kind of method that from the low pure method pulping waste liquor that boils, reclaims lignin, pulping waste liquor is from the slurrying of base catalysis poplar methanol-water, and the lignin recycling step is as follows:
1. flash distillation dilution: 200 ℃ of dense waste liquid temperatures, methanol concentration are 50%, and after the flash tank flash distillation, temperature is reduced to 98 ℃, and methanol concentration is reduced to 30%, and being diluted to methanol concentration with the normal temperature water for industrial use is 20%, is cooled to 25 ℃ through heat exchanger;
2. filtration drying: the lignin of precipitating is through filtering, after the drying, obtaining lignin, 100g poplar raw material results lignin 14g;
3. filtrate is processed: add calcium hydroxide in filtrate, addition is 3g/L, and precipitating is filtered, drying obtains low molecule lignin, the low molecule lignin 0.6g of 100g poplar raw material results.
Embodiment 3
A kind of method that from the low pure method pulping waste liquor that boils, reclaims lignin, pulping waste liquor is from the slurrying of self-catalysis poplar alcohol-water, and the lignin recycling step is as follows:
1. flash distillation dilution: 205 ℃ of concentrated black liquid temperature, concentration of alcohol are 55%, and after the flash tank flash distillation, temperature is reduced to 96 ℃, and concentration of alcohol is reduced to 35%, and it is 15% that the Recycled ethanol aqueous solution with 5% is diluted to concentration of alcohol, are cooled to 25 ℃ through heat exchanger;
2. filtration drying: the lignin of precipitating is through filtering, after the drying, obtaining lignin, 100g poplar raw material results lignin 13g;
3. filtrate is processed: add calcium hydroxide in filtrate, addition is 4g/L, and precipitating is filtered, drying obtains low molecule lignin, the low molecule lignin 0.7g of 100g poplar raw material results.
